摘要

The calculation of software reliability is chiefly dependent on choice of software reliability models (SRMs) and the ways of software reliability computation is not invariable through software life cycle as well. In this paper, a multi-variables two-way learning fuzzy neural network is presented, by which the problem of comparison and choice of SRMs could be solved effectively and the system reliability factors could be decided as early as possible.
